A 2025 survey of more than 49,000 developers in 177 countries reveals a disturbing paradox in the adoption of the AI. Artificial intelligence continues to be used in climbing – 84 % of developers are now using or planning to use artificial intelligence tools, up from 76 % in 2024. However, confidence has been confident in these tools.

“One of the most surprising results was a major shift in the preferences of developers for Amnesty International compared to previous years, while most developers use artificial intelligence, they love them less and trust this year,” said Erine Yips, Senior Service in Market Research and Vision in Stack Overflow. “This response is surprising because with all investment in artificial intelligence and focusing on it in technology news, I expect confidence to grow with the improvement of technology.”
The numbers tell the story. Only 33 % of the developers trust artificial intelligence in 2025, a decrease from 43 % in 2024 and 42 % in 2023. Mu connect to artificial intelligence decreased from 77 % in 2023 to 72 % in 2024 to only 60 % this year.
But survey data reveals more urgent concern for technical decision makers. The developers cite that “almost correct artificial intelligence solutions, but not quite” as their most important frustration – is 66 % for this problem. Meanwhile, 45 % says the correction of the mistakes created by artificial intelligence takes longer than expected. Artificial intelligence tools are productivity gains, but they may create new categories of technical debts.
The phenomenon of “righteous” is almost disrupted
Artificial intelligence tools not only produce a broken symbol. It generates reasonable solutions that require a major intervention of developers to be ready for production. This creates a special production problem in particular.
“It seems that the tools of artificial intelligence have a global promise to save time and increase productivity, but developers spend time handling unintended breakdowns in the workflow caused by artificial intelligence.” “Most developers say that artificial intelligence tools do not deal with complexity, as only 29 % believe that artificial intelligence tools can deal with complex problems this year, decreasing from 35 % last year.”
Unlike clearly broken code, developers determine and ignore them quickly, “almost correct” solutions require an accurate analysis. The developers must understand what is wrong and how to fix it. Many reporting reports that it would be faster to write the symbol from scratch instead of correcting the solutions created from artificial intelligence.
The disruption of the workflow extends beyond the individual coding tasks. The poll found that 54 % of developers use six or more to complete their jobs. This adds general expenditures to switch context to a already complex development process.

The rapid adoption of AI has surpassed the capabilities of the governance of institutions. Institutions are now facing the risks of security and potential technical debts that have not been fully addressed.
“VIBE coding requires a higher level of confidence in artificial intelligence output, and sacrifices with potential trust and security interests in a faster transformation symbol,” Ben Matthews, chief engineer in Stack Overflow, told Venturebeat.
The developers are largely refused to codish professional work, as 77 % indicated that it is not part of the professional development process. However, the poll reveals gaps in how to manage the institutions generated by the quality of the code created.
Matthews warns that the AI coded tools that work by LLMS can produce errors. He pointed out that although knowledgeable developers are able to identify and test the weak code themselves, LLMS is sometimes unable to record any errors that you may produce.
Security risks these quality problems gather. The survey data shows that when developers still turn into humans for coding assistance, 61.7 % indicate “ethical or security concerns about software instructions” as a major reason. This indicates that the tools of artificial intelligence provide the challenges of integration on access to data, performance and safety that institutions are still learning to manage.
The developers are still using a staple and other sources of human experience
Despite the low confidence, developers do not abandon the tools of artificial intelligence. They are developing more sophisticated strategies to integrate them into the workflow. The poll shows that 69 % of the developers have spent time learning new coding techniques or programming languages last year. Among these, he used 44 % of the tools that support artificial intelligence to learn, up from 37 % in 2024.
Even with the appearance of VIBE and AI coding, survey data shows that developers maintain strong contacts with human experience and community resources. Stack Overflow is still the first community platform using 84 %. GitHub follows 67 % and YouTube by 61 %. It is very important that 89 % of developers visit a stacked capacity several times a month. Among these, it resorted to 35 % to the platform specifically after facing problems with artificial intelligence responses.
